Improve Home Energy Efficiency

Damaged ducts can bleed up to 30% of your conditioned air, raising your monthly utility costs. A professional home energy audit pinpoints where energy escapes. By fixing these issues, you improve your home’s climate control and enjoy lower utility bills all year long.

Duct Leak Detection

Even small leaks in your ducts can sabotage your cooling efficiency. Using smoke tests, a licensed tech performs duct leak detection to pinpoint problem areas. Once found, repair solutions can restore system performance and cut energy loss.

Average Price Range

Basic air duct assessments in Calgary typically range from C$150 to C$300, depending on home size. This cost often includes airflow balance testing, offering critical insights into your HVAC performance.

What Do Technicians Inspect Ductwork in a Calgary Home?

A licensed HVAC technician typically begins with a visual assessment and then uses a high-resolution video duct camera to navigate inside your system, detecting leaks, blockages, or damage. This method allows for accurate duct leak detection and a complete furnace duct inspection without invasive wall removal. The process also includes an airflow balance testing and duct insulation check to assess efficiency and identify areas where duct sealing services could help.
